About The Role

Duties

  • Assist Survey Crew Chief in performing field work for route, topographic, boundary, ALTA/ACSM, construction staking and R/W staking surveys
  • Perform project research
  • Perform reconnaissance for all pertinent survey control information
  • Collect and Layout accurate survey data for route, topographic, boundary, ALTA/ACSM, construction staking and R/W staking surveys
  • Accurately record field notes in a field book
  • Assist in downloading and uploading information to data collectors
  • Communicate with field and office staff to provide quality services
  • Maintain all field equipment and vehicle
  • Maintain confidentiality of information regarding clients and company practices
  • Perform other duties as assigned

Skills

  • Possess good communication skills
  • Able to work within a “team concept”
  • Proficient in use of total stations, GPS equipment, differential levels and data collectors
  • Working knowledge of construction plans for public works projects
  • Ability to meet deadlines

Requirements

Physical Requirements

  • Able to work 9 or more hours per work day
  • Able to work 40 or more hours per work week, as needed
  • Able to work outdoors in all weather conditions traversing uneven or difficult terrain while carrying survey equipment
  • Able to drive survey vehicle
  • Able to drive rebar, lath, stakes and/or hubs into the ground as needed
  • Able to dig and/or probe into pavement or ground for pertinent survey information
  • Able to lift utility structure lids or covers
